4-Bedroom 2-Story Southern Farmhouse with 2-Story Great Room (Floor Plan)

Specifications:

  • 4,242 Sq Ft
  • 4 Beds
  • 4.5+ Baths
  • 2 Stories
  • 3 Cars

When I first laid eyes on this 4-bedroom Southern farmhouse floor plan, I was instantly drawn to its balance of classic charm and functional design.

With 4,242 square feet spread over two stories, the layout perfectly marries grandeur with everyday livability.

From the sweeping front porch veranda to the sunken living room and a two-story great room, every detail feels thoughtfully planned.

Let’s explore how each part of this home works together.

Welcoming Foyer with Twin Stairwells

Entering the home, the foyer makes a statement without being intimidating.

With 10-foot ceilings and twin stairwells, the design exudes symmetry and elegance.

The foyer flows seamlessly into the sunken living room, creating a natural progression that’s both functional and inviting.

It’s easy to imagine greeting guests here or just soaking in the morning light from the front windows while enjoying your coffee.

The layout sets the tone for the rest of the house: open, connected, and warm.

Sunken Living Room and French Doors

The sunken living room is the heart of this farmhouse plan.

With built-in storage and a cozy wood-burning fireplace, it’s perfect for family gatherings or quiet evenings.

French doors open directly onto the outdoor dining veranda, blending indoor and outdoor living in true Southern style.

This layout ensures that entertaining flows naturally, whether you’re hosting a dinner party or enjoying a quiet night at home.

Chef’s Kitchen with Built-Ins and Buffet Area

Adjacent to the living room, the chef’s kitchen is both beautiful and practical.

The built-in cabinetry provides ample storage, while the buffet area is ideal for serving meals or snacks during gatherings.

Conveniently located near the port-cochere and utility area, the kitchen’s placement makes chores and meal prep effortless.

The floor plan ensures that daily routines are streamlined, with smooth connections to both dining and outdoor spaces.

Private Guest Suite on the Main Level

One of my favorite features of this floor plan is the main-level guest suite.

Complete with a full bath and walk-in closet, it offers visitors privacy without isolation.

Guests can enjoy comfort and independence while still being close to the main living areas.

It’s a smart design choice that balances hospitality with practicality.

Master Suite

The master suite is practically a private wing of the home.

Divided into a study, a sitting area with fireplace and TV, and a sunken bedroom with bay windows, it’s designed for relaxation and productivity.

The master bath boasts a Roman tub, separate shower, and a large walk-in closet.

Direct access to a covered porch creates a personal retreat that blends indoor and outdoor living.

The layout of the master suite emphasizes comfort, privacy, and versatility, making it a standout feature of the floor plan.

Upstairs Bedrooms

Upstairs, two equally sized bedrooms give children their own space while maintaining symmetry and flow.

Each bedroom includes a private bath, closet, and study area.

This floor plan thoughtfully separates these rooms from the main living areas, ensuring privacy and independence for older kids while keeping them close enough for supervision.

The layout balances family cohesion with personal space perfectly.

Two-Story Great Room

The two-story great room is the centerpiece of the home, providing a dramatic sense of space and connection between the floors.

Positioned at the center of the plan, it links the foyer, living room, and kitchen while maintaining a strong visual impact.

The open vertical space allows light to flood the main living areas, creating an airy, welcoming atmosphere.

Rear Courtyard and Outdoor Living

The rear courtyard is positioned thoughtfully within the floor plan, making it ideal for a pool or spa.

Access from the sunken living room and kitchen ensures easy indoor-outdoor movement.

Whether for entertaining guests or enjoying a quiet evening outdoors, this courtyard feels like a natural extension of the home.

Three-Car Garage

The three-car garage is strategically located for ease of access while preserving the aesthetic of the farmhouse exterior.

It provides ample storage and versatility, accommodating vehicles, hobbies, or seasonal items.

The floor plan ensures that the garage is functional without disrupting the main flow of the home, making everyday routines smooth and convenient.

Circulation and Flow

One of the most impressive aspects of this floor plan is how each space connects.

The foyer, sunken living room, and great room create a cohesive path that’s both intuitive and elegant.

Bedrooms are positioned for privacy, while common areas encourage gathering.

The layout supports multiple activities at once—kids doing homework upstairs, guests enjoying the main floor, and family members relaxing in the great room—all without feeling cramped or disconnected.

Main-Level Amenities

Beyond aesthetics, the main floor emphasizes practicality.

The kitchen’s proximity to the port-cochere and utility area reduces steps for unloading groceries or doing laundry.

The guest suite ensures visitors are comfortable without intruding on the family’s daily routines.

Even the flow from the great room to the outdoor veranda supports a balance of indoor and outdoor living.

Every square foot is used efficiently, demonstrating the thoughtfulness behind the floor plan.

Master Suite and Private Outdoor Access

Returning to the master suite, it’s worth noting how the layout enhances comfort.

The sunken bedroom and sitting area create separate zones for rest and leisure, while bay windows add charm and natural light.

Direct access to the covered porch extends the suite outdoors, making it perfect for morning coffee or evening relaxation.

The floor plan clearly prioritizes lifestyle and functionality, showing how luxury and practicality can coexist.

Upstairs Privacy and Function

The upstairs bedrooms aren’t just equally sized—they’re carefully designed for study, sleep, and personal space.

Each has a private bath, closet, and study area, giving kids independence while remaining close to family life.

This thoughtful separation allows multiple household activities to occur simultaneously without disruption, highlighting how well the floor plan balances privacy and interaction.

Outdoor Living Integration

The outdoor spaces, including the front porch veranda and rear courtyard, are seamlessly integrated with the interior layout.

The flow from living room to veranda or courtyard allows for easy entertaining, outdoor dining, and casual relaxation.

This design creates a strong connection between indoor and outdoor living while maintaining a sense of privacy.

Functional Storage and Garage Layout

Storage is cleverly incorporated throughout the home.

Built-ins in the living room, walk-in closets in bedrooms, and the three-car garage provide ample space for belongings without cluttering the main living areas.

The garage’s location near the utility areas and port-cochere makes daily routines efficient, showing how the floor plan addresses practical needs while supporting style.

Thoughtful Room Placement

Overall, the floor plan reflects careful consideration of room placement and flow.

Common areas are centralized for social activities, while bedrooms are positioned for privacy.

The two-story great room anchors the home visually and spatially, creating a sense of openness.

The design encourages movement and connection, ensuring the home functions as both a gathering place and a private retreat.

This Southern farmhouse isn’t just a house; it’s a well-designed home where form and function meet.

The layout accommodates daily life, entertaining, privacy, and comfort across 4,242 square feet.

Every space, from the sunken living room to the master suite, demonstrates thoughtful planning.

It’s a floor plan that supports both family living and stylish design—a true blueprint for modern Southern living.
